Diamond Mesh for Reinforced Plaster Walls

When erecting walls using plaster, incorporating diamond mesh provides a crucial layer of durability. This robust mesh is specifically formulated to support the plaster, stopping cracks and boosting its overall integrity.

Diamond mesh typically comes in a variety of dimensions, allowing for customized solutions depending on the requirement of the wall. Placement is comparatively simple, involving securing the mesh to the wall surface before applying the plaster.

  • Advantages of using diamond mesh in reinforced plaster walls include:
  • Enhanced strength and stability
  • Split resistance
  • Improved durability
  • Economical solution

Installing Diamond Mesh for a Durable Plaster Surface

When getting ready your walls for plastering, installing diamond mesh is an essential step. This strong mesh provides exceptional tensile strength, strengthening the plaster and preventing fracturing. Before you begin, ensure your walls are clean, dry, and free of any loose debris. , After that apply a layer of plaster adhesive to the wall surface, following the manufacturer's recommendations. Firmly press the diamond mesh into the adhesive, ensuring complete coverage with the wall. Extending the mesh at each joint by at least 2 inches is crucial for a strong and seamless finish. Allow the adhesive to harden completely before applying the plaster layer.

Selecting the Right Diamond Mesh for Your Plaster Project

When tackling a plaster project, the selection of diamond mesh plays a crucial role in ensuring a durable and long-lasting finish. Diamond mesh, frequently known as wire mesh, provides a reinforcing framework within the plaster, preventing damage.

The ideal diamond mesh for your project depends on several factors, including the thickness of the plaster layer, the substrate you are working with, and the specific application. For heavier plaster coats, a coarser diamond mesh with larger openings is recommended. This allows for greater flexibility and strength. Conversely, for thinner plaster applications, a finer mesh with tighter openings will provide sufficient support.

Consider the substrate also. If working on drywall, a standard diamond mesh is usually appropriate. However, for brick substrates, a heavier-duty mesh with sturdier wires may be necessary.

Ultimately, choosing the right diamond mesh involves careful consideration of your project's specific requirements. Consulting with a building professional or referring to manufacturer guidelines can provide valuable insights and ensure a successful outcome.
